Physical Security Measures in Boarding Schools
The first layer of protection comes from physical security, which is implemented through advanced infrastructure and trained personnel.
-
CCTV Surveillance: Schools are equipped with cameras in all common areas, ensuring continuous monitoring.
-
Secure Entry and Exit Points: Biometric systems and visitor logs prevent unauthorized access.
-
Security Guards: Trained guards are stationed at strategic points within the campus, ensuring constant vigilance.
-
Controlled Access to Dormitories: Only authorized staff and students can enter residential areas.

Disaster Preparedness and Emergency Drills
Shimla is located in a hilly terrain, so schools take extra care in planning for natural calamities or emergencies.
-
Fire Safety Measures: Fire alarms, extinguishers, and regular evacuation drills are mandatory.
-
Earthquake Preparedness: Students and staff are trained in evacuation during tremors.
-
Medical Emergency Plans: Staff undergoes first-aid and CPR training to handle health crises.
-
Communication Channels: Parents are informed promptly during any emergency situation.
